Per i blogger individuali, le piccole imprese o gli imprenditori che creano un sito web per la prima volta, l’hosting condiviso rappresenta spesso la scelta più conveniente e semplice da utilizzare per iniziare. È un po“ come un ”appartamento condiviso” su Internet: più siti web condividono le risorse di un unico server fisico (CPU, memoria, spazio di archiviazione). Il fornitore di servizi si occupa della manutenzione di tutto l’hardware, della rete e del software di base, mentre gli utenti possono gestire lo spazio dedicato al proprio sito web tramite un semplice pannello di controllo. Questo modello riduce notevolmente gli ostacoli tecnici e i costi, permettendo alle persone di concentrarsi esclusivamente sul contenuto del sito web stesso.
Tuttavia, i server condivisi non sono la soluzione ideale per tutti i casi. La loro natura “condivisa” implica anche limitazioni nelle risorse disponibili; inoltre, un aumento improvviso del traffico dei siti web che condividono lo stesso server può influire temporaneamente sulle prestazioni del tuo sito. Per questo motivo, è fondamentale seguire un percorso accurato: partire dalla comprensione dei principi di funzionamento dei server condivisi, passare a una scelta informata del provider, e infine procedere all’ottimizzazione del sito dopo il suo deployment. Ogni passo di questo processo è essenziale per garantire il corretto funzionamento del tuo sito web.
Concetti fondamentali e meccanismi di funzionamento degli host condivisi
Per sfruttare al meglio un host condiviso, è necessario prima di tutto comprendere la logica tecnica che sta alla base del suo funzionamento e i termini chiave correlati.
Si consiglia di leggere Analisi approfondita dell'hosting condiviso: una guida completa dal concetto all'acquisto e all'ottimizzazione.。
Modello di condivisione delle risorse
Su un server ad alte prestazioni, l’operatore di servizi utilizza la tecnologia di virtualizzazione per creare decine o addirittura centinaia di spazi di account indipendenti. Ogni account dispone di una directory di file, di un database, di un account FTP e di un account di posta elettronica propri. Questi account condividono le risorse di calcolo principali del server, come il processore centrale, la memoria e la larghezza di banda. L’operatore di servizi monitora e distribuisce le risorse tramite software, per garantire che nessun utente non ne occupi un’eccessiva quantità e quindi non influisca negativamente sugli altri utenti.
Analisi dei componenti chiave
Un tipico pacchetto di hosting condiviso include diversi componenti fondamentali: lo spazio di archiviazione per i siti web, utilizzato per conservare i file relativi ai siti; il traffico mensile, ovvero la quantità totale di dati che è possibile trasmettere ogni mese; il supporto per database, solitamente MySQL o PostgreSQL; account di posta elettronica che consentono di inviare e ricevere messaggi utilizzando un proprio dominio; e, soprattutto, il pannello di controllo, come cPanel, Plesk o DirectAdmin, che fornisce un’interfaccia grafica per gestire tutte le funzionalità menzionate.
Vantaggi e limitazioni
Il principale vantaggio degli host condivisi è il loro bassissimo costo, la semplicità di gestione e l’offerta di servizi completi in un unico pacchetto (come nomi di dominio, certificati SSL, account email). Tuttavia, esistono anche delle limitazioni: le prestazioni sono influenzate dall’ambiente condiviso, la personalizzazione è ridotta (ad esempio, non è possibile installare software server specifici), e la sicurezza dipende in parte dalla protezione fornita dal provider e dalla sicurezza dei siti web con cui l’host condiviso è connesso.
Come scegliere un servizio di hosting condiviso adatto alle proprie esigenze?
Di fronte all’ampia gamma di soluzioni di hosting condiviso disponibili sul mercato, seguire un quadro di valutazione chiaro può aiutarti a evitare errori e a trovare la scelta migliore.
Identifica i tuoi bisogni.
Prima di iniziare a confrontare le opzioni, poniti alcune domande: Qual è la prevista quantità di visite mensili al sito web? Con quale programma è stato creato (ad esempio, WordPress, Joomla)? Quanto spazio di archiviazione è necessario per immagini e file? È richiesto il supporto per un linguaggio di programmazione specifico (ad esempio, una versione particolare di PHP) o per un database? Definire con chiarezza le proprie esigenze è il primo passo per evitare di pagare per funzionalità che non verranno utilizzate.
Si consiglia di leggere 共享主机是什么?新手入门指南与主流方案深度解析。
Indici chiave per valutare un fornitore di servizi
不要只看价格。应重点关注:服务器的正常运行时间保证(通常应高于99.9%);客户支持的渠道(24/7在线聊天、电话、工单)和响应速度;是否提供免费的网站迁移服务;数据中心的地理位置(选择靠近你目标受众的位置可以降低延迟);以及是否包含免费的SSL证书(如Let‘s Encrypt)和自动备份功能。
Fate attenzione alle trappole del marketing e ai costi nascosti.
Molti offerti promozionali a basso costo si riferiscono al prezzo per il primo anno; i prezzi di rinnovo possono aumentare notevolmente successivamente. Leggi attentamente i termini e le condizioni di servizio e fai attenzione a eventuali clausole nascoste che prevedano una “quantità illimitata di traffico” ma limitazioni sull’utilizzo della CPU. Consulta anche le recensioni degli utenti, soprattutto quelle riguardanti la stabilità del server e la qualità del supporto tecnico.
Guida alla distribuzione del sito web e alle configurazioni di base
Dopo aver acquistato con successo il server, il suo corretto deployment rappresenta la base per il funzionamento stabile del sito web.
Impostazione dell’associazione tra il dominio e l’indirizzo IP e configurazione del DNS
Se hai acquistato un dominio presso un provider, il processo di associazione del dominio al server hosting è solitamente automatico. Se il dominio proviene da un altro registratore, devi impostare i server DNS (Domain Name System) del dominio in modo che puntino agli indirizzi forniti dal provider, oppure aggiungere un record “A” nel pannello di gestione del dominio, indirizzando il dominio all’IP address assegnata al tuo server hosting. Questo processo può richiedere da alcune ore a 48 ore per diventare effettivo a livello globale.
Gestire in modo efficiente utilizzando il Pannello di controllo
Prendendo come esempio il popolare cPanel, è necessario essere familiari con alcune funzionalità fondamentali. Il “File Manager” permette di caricare e modificare direttamente i file del sito web; la sezione “Database” consente di creare e gestire database MySQL nonché utenti; la parte relativa all“”Email“ permette di configurare account di posta elettronica aziendale; la funzione di ”Installazione in un clic” (come Softaculous) consente di installare applicazioni come WordPress in pochi minuti, gestendo automaticamente la creazione del database e la configurazione dei file.
Primo passo nella configurazione della sicurezza
Dopo il deployment, è necessario modificare immediatamente tutte le password predefinite, inclusa quella per l’accesso a cPanel, quella per FTP e quelle per i database. Abilitare obbligatoriamente l’uso di HTTPS nel pannello di controllo per garantire l’criptazione SSL per l’intero sito web. Impostare i diritti di accesso ai file in base alle raccomandazioni del programma utilizzato per il sito (ad esempio, i file principali dovrebbero avere i diritti 644, mentre le cartelle 755).
Si consiglia di leggere Guida completa all’acquisto di un host condiviso: come scegliere la soluzione di hosting più adatta al tuo sito web。
Pratiche avanzate di ottimizzazione delle prestazioni e sicurezza
Anche in un ambiente condiviso, è possibile migliorare notevolmente la velocità e la sicurezza di un sito web attraverso una serie di misure di ottimizzazione.
Tecniche per ottimizzare le prestazioni del sito web
Attivare i meccanismi di cache offerti dai fornitori di servizi, come LSCache per i server LiteSpeed. Installare plugin di cache in applicazioni come WordPress (ad esempio W3 Total Cache o WP Super Cache). Ridurre le dimensioni delle immagini prima di caricarle, utilizzando strumenti come TinyPNG per comprimerle. Semplificare l’utilizzo di plugin e temi, eliminando codice non necessario o di bassa qualità. Queste misure possono ridurre il carico sul server e i tempi di caricamento delle pagine.
Misure per migliorare la sicurezza
Aggiornare regolarmente i programmi del sito web, i temi e i plugin alle versioni più recenti è una delle abitudini di sicurezza più importanti. Utilizzare password robuste e considerare l’attivazione della autenticazione a due fattori fornita da cPanel. Effettuare periodicamente copie di backup complete del sito web tramite il pannello di controllo o i plugin, e salvare tali file su un disco locale o in un altro servizio di archiviazione cloud. È possibile installare plugin di sicurezza (ad esempio Wordfence per WordPress) per monitorare il traffico maligno e i tentativi di accesso non autorizzati.
Monitoraggio e manutenzione ordinari
Utilizza strumenti come Google Search Console e Analytics per monitorare lo stato di salute del sito web e il suo traffico. Controlla regolarmente le statistiche sull’utilizzo delle risorse presenti in cPanel (come CPU, memoria, processi in esecuzione), al fine di comprendere i modelli di consumo di risorse del sito e poter eventualmente aggiornare il piano di servizi in anticipo, se necessario. Elimina email obsolete, tabelle del database e versioni vecchie del sito web per liberare spazio di archiviazione.
Riassumendo
I server condivisi rappresentano un punto di partenza ideale per individui e piccole imprese che desiderano avviare la propria attività online. Grazie al modello di condivisione delle risorse, offrono costi estremamente bassi e una gestione semplificata. La chiave del successo consiste nel comprendere il concetto fondamentale che “la condivisione implica anche delle limitazioni”, nonché nel scegliere con attenzione il provider di servizi in base alle proprie esigenze. Un’installazione corretta dopo l’acquisto, una configurazione di sicurezza di base e un’attenta manutenzione costante sono elementi essenziali per garantire che il sito web fornisca un’esperienza di accesso rapida, stabile e sicura anche in un ambiente condiviso. Man mano che il sito web si sviluppa, e quando le limitazioni dei server condivisi iniziano a ostacolare la sua crescita, arriva il momento giusto per considerare l’upgrade a un VPS (Virtual Private Server) o a un server cloud.
FAQ - Domande frequenti
I server condivisi sono adatti ai siti web con un elevato traffico di visitatori?
Non è adatto. Le risorse di un host condiviso sono condivise, e ci sono solitamente limitazioni rigide per quanto riguarda CPU, memoria e numero di connessioni simultanee. I siti web con un elevato traffico (ad esempio, con oltre migliaia di visitatori al giorno) possono facilmente superare tali limitazioni, causando rallentamenti o addirittura la sospensione temporanea del sito stesso. In questi casi, è consigliabile utilizzare un VPS o un server indipendente.
È possibile ospitare più siti web all’interno dello stesso account di hosting condiviso?
Dipende dal pacchetto di hosting che hai acquistato. Molti pacchetti di hosting condiviso supportano la funzionalità dei “domini aggiuntivi”, che ti permettono di gestire più siti web completamente indipendenti all’interno dello stesso account, condividendo lo stesso pool di risorse. Devi verificare quante domini aggiuntivi il pacchetto consente e aggiungerli e gestirli tramite il pannello di controllo.
Qual è la principale differenza tra l'hosting condiviso e l'hosting VPS?
La differenza principale risiede nell’allocazione delle risorse e nei diritti di gestione. I server condivisi offrono una condivisione “soft” delle risorse, che può essere influenzata dai server adiacenti; inoltre, i diritti degli utenti sono limitati (solitamente gestibili solo tramite il pannello di controllo). I VPS (Virtual Private Server), invece, sono server virtuali creati tramite tecnologie di virtualizzazione e dispongono di risorse dedicate (CPU, memoria e spazio disco), nonché di diritti di accesso a livello di root o amministratore, simili a quelli di un server fisico indipendente. Questo garantisce prestazioni più stabili e un maggiore grado di controllabilità.
Cosa devo fare se il mio sito web viene influenzato da un attacco da parte di altri utenti che condividono le risorse del server?
Contatta immediatamente il servizio di assistenza tecnica del tuo provider di hosting. Un provider affidabile ha la responsabilità di mantenere sicuro l’intero ambiente del server. Spiega loro la situazione: potranno esaminare i log del server, individuare la fonte del problema (ad esempio, un sito web vicino che ha subito un attacco) e attuare misure di isolamento. Inoltre, assicurati che il tuo sito web abbia aggiornato tutti i software e che siano state attivate le corrette impostazioni di sicurezza.
Devo installare il sistema operativo da solo per il mio host condiviso?
Non è affatto necessario. Questo rappresenta uno dei grandi vantaggi dell’hosting condiviso: il provider ha già installato e configurato per te l’intero sistema operativo del server (ad esempio Linux), il software del server web (come Apache o Nginx), il database e tutti gli altri componenti fondamentali dell’infrastruttura. Dopo aver effettuato l’accesso, ti troverai direttamente di fronte al pannello di controllo utilizzato per gestire il sito web, senza dover intervenire sulla riga di comando o effettuare configurazioni a livello di sistema.
Il prossimo passo, cosa dovremo fare dopo?
Per una lettura approfondita e conoscenza pratica
I seguenti contenuti sono correlati all'argomento di questo articolo e sono adatti per una lettura approfondita. È consigliabile iniziare con l'articolo più vicino al tuo problema attuale, per poi passare gradualmente agli argomenti correlati, il che di solito dà risultati migliori.
- Il guida definitiva per creare siti web con WordPress: dall’essere principianti a diventare esperti, per creare siti professionali
- Guida completa all’acquisto di nomi di dominio e alla creazione di siti web: da registrazione all’attivazione online.
- Guida all'acquisto di un hosting condiviso: come scegliere la migliore soluzione di hosting per il tuo sito web.
- Analisi approfondita dei server condivisi: guida completa sui concetti di base, vantaggi e svantaggi, nonché sugli scenari di utilizzo
- Guida definitiva all’acquisto di hosting condiviso adatto per l’SEO: come scegliere la soluzione di hosting più adatta al tuo sito web